Style Watch: Classic Updo

Beyonce, pictured at the 2008 Kennedy Center Honors, rocked a classic updo - - the prime example of a hairstyle that will never get old. An updo is a great way to add a hint of sophistication and class to your everyday style. For the winter, try it on a day when you won't need a hat. Nothing ruins a hairstyle faster than smooshing it with a hat. I'm a fan of less perfect hair so I'd suggest adding a cute messy bun of some sort to the back and though big hair is fun, I'd lower the poof up top a bit.
